| How to get to the Hotel |
|
There are many ways to get to the new Best Western Camino a Tamarindo. Our unbeatable location warranty you the best and easy way to discover Guanacaste: Tamarindo, Papagayo Gulf, etc. Driving From Liberia or Liberia International Airport.
Local FlightTo get to BW Camino a Tamarindo from San Jose it is possible to take a 50 minute flight to Tamarindo, where the airport is located. A shuttle from the hotel will pick you up there (upon request) and in less than ten minutes you will be at the hotel. You can also rent a car in San José; our activity center can help you with this, and make the 100 mile drive through different communities and beautiful forests. A daily flight round trip San José-Tamarindo, just... fly by SANSA If you happen to arrive at Daniel Oduber International Airport in Liberia or Juan Santamaria in San Jose, our reservation center can arrange taxi service or car rental and make a reservation for you, so that you can enjoy the ride from Liberia. We can help you choose transportation according to your needs. DrivingLeaving San José, take the Pan-American Highway west to Puntarenas. Near Puntarenas the road veers north - follow the signs to Liberia-, and take the turn off for the La Amistad Bridge. Once you have crossed over the Gulf of Nicoya, head to the town of Santa Cruz. From Santa Cruz, head west towards Tamarindo, and after about 25 minutes on this road, take the turn off onto a non paved road and, following the signs, you will reach Villa Real. Do not turn left. Head towards Huacas for another five minutes, If you are coming from Liberia, just take the south road, look for Belen, and follow the signs. You will see our informative signs at different points along the road to Tamarind Beach. At the intersection in Huacas, go two miles on the main road towards Tamarindo. Car RentalThere are many car rental companies in Costa Rica, but we recommend Adobe. Private TransferWe can arrange a private transfer with a very reliable driver from San José to Tamarindo or Liberia to Tamarindo. Regular BusA direct bus departs daily from San José to Tamarindo. It leaves at 3:00 p.m., from the Alfaro bus terminal, 14th street, 5th avenue (la Coca Cola). The trip takes 5 hours to reach Tamarindo. Be advised buses are not equipped with a/c. ShuttleSan José to Tamarindo, a direct van with a/c departs daily for $39 per person |
